Transaction 7efb24bf9cadd44d959e54161dca0f070d540f5f7130ba2e9747580ea9e5dcf4

1 Input
2 Outputs
  • 7efb24bf9cadd44d959e54161dca0f070d540f5f7130ba2e9747580ea9e5dcf4:0
  • value  74036178
    address  16AiFhhQ3kvoSfg1c3bxN992hQFbmENUyJ
  • 7efb24bf9cadd44d959e54161dca0f070d540f5f7130ba2e9747580ea9e5dcf4:1
  • value  3450000
    address  1KA2T59df6Hn98CH7LgFbhspmJwLWac3rE